WOMEN’S MINISTRY

Who are we?

At the heart of our Women’s Ministry is a desire to see women grow in faith, build meaningful friendships, and walk through life together with purpose and joy. We’re a team of women committed to reaching others with compassion and responding to real needs—whether spiritual, emotional, or practical.

We believe connection matters. God designed us for community, and there’s something powerful that happens when women come together to encourage, support, and lift each other up in love.

What do we do?

We gather bi-weekly at the church for Bible study and small groups—spaces where faith deepens and authentic conversations happen. These times are more than just learning; they’re about sharing life, praying for each other, and growing together in Christ.

Beyond our regular meetings, we host retreats and special events to help women step away from the busyness of everyday life and reconnect—with God and with one another. These moments of refreshment and fun are where lasting memories and friendships are often formed.

  • Fall Women's Bible Study

    Start date Monday Sept 22nd

    The phrase "What the Women Saw" refers to a Bible study series focusing on the women in the Bible who interacted with Jesus and the significance of their perspectives. It highlights how Jesus valued and cared for women, emphasizing their roles in his ministry and the Kingdom of God. The study explores the faith and experiences of women like Mary, Martha, and Mary Magdalene, showcasing how they encountered Jesus and were impacted by him.
